NEAR Foundation Launches $20M AI Agent Fund to Boost Decentralized AI

The NEAR Foundation, a prominent blockchain organization, has recently unveiled a $20 million AI Agent Fund aimed at boosting decentralized AI development. This initiative is set to accelerate the growth and adoption of AI agents in the blockchain ecosystem, fostering innovation and competition in the burgeoning field of decentralized AI.

The fund, which is part of the NEAR Foundation's broader mission to support the development of decentralized technologies, will provide financial backing and resources to projects and teams working on AI agents. This includes research and development, infrastructure support, and community building efforts. The NEAR Foundation is committed to fostering a vibrant and diverse ecosystem of AI agents, enabling them to thrive and contribute to the growth of the NEAR blockchain network.

The AI Agent Fund is expected to attract a wide range of projects, from early-stage startups to established AI developers. By providing funding and support, the NEAR Foundation aims to create an environment that encourages experimentation, collaboration, and growth. This, in turn, will help to drive the adoption of AI agents and decentralized AI technologies across various industries and use cases.
